Cutting the roll paper at other times
1. Press the Paper Feed button to position the paper in place
for cutting.
2. Press the Paper Source button repeatedly until the Roll Auto
Cut light is on.
3. Press the Cut/Eject button. The roll paper is cut.
Printing page lines
If you want to print continuously on roll paper first, then cut the
page yourself after you finish printing, use the Print Page Line
setting. To make the Print Page Line setting using the control
panel, see "SelecType Settings" on page 16. To use the printer
software, see "Using the Roll Paper Settings" on page 46.
Using Cut Sheet Media
Loading cut sheet media
To load cut sheet media, follow the steps below. To load thick
paper (0.5 mm or thicker), see "Printing on thick paper (0.5 mm
or thicker)" on page 96.
Note:
You may want to set the paper basket before printing. See "Setting the
Paper Basket" on page 98. (In the illustrations below the paper basket is
set to feed paper backwards.)
1. Make sure that the printer is on and the roll paper cover is
closed.
2. Press the Paper Source button repeatedly until the Sheet
light is on.
